Airdrie Xtreme split weekend series with win against Oilers, loss to Golden Hawks
Sport Shorts:
The Airdrie Xtreme came away from back-to-back weekend games with a win and a loss. It defeated the Okotoks Oilers 7-1, Oct. 13. Jordan McConnell scored a hat trick and Brandon Schuldhaus recorded a goal and an assist. Noah Philp and Jared Janke also had multiple point games.
The Xtreme took on the Lethbridge Golden Hawks Oct. 14 and lost 3-1. Andrew Fyten scored the team’s only goal with Barrett Sheen and Shaye Seefrid recording assists.

AC Avalanche
It was a winning weekend for the AC Avalanche. It defeated the CBHA Blackhawks 7-4, Oct. 13. Kris LeClair led the team in scoring with two goals, while Troy VanTetering recorded four assists. Chad Harrison had three assists, while Kyle Antochow and Andrew McLeod each had two points.
The team also defeated the NWCAA Bruins 5-4, Oct. 14. VanTetering has another multi-point game with a goal and two assists while Harrison added two more assists to his season point total. Jayden Gordon recorded one goal and one assist.
